    The problem with movies today is that most of them are sticking to tried and true formulas, because movies are expensive. That's why most new movies are either remakes or sequels or reboots. Coupled with the fact that the American attention span is used to entertainemtn in hour long chunks like TV, and you have bland plots with easily followable storylines so as not to confuse the ADD population who will just whip out their smartphone and play Angry Birds if the movie sucks, and then download it instead of buying it when it comes out on DvD.
